Re: Trotter and Woodaz improved. Carter didn't.

2

Dec 16, 2024, 7:09 PM [ in reply to Trotter and Woodaz improved. Carter didn't. ]

Carter improved a bit from the 2023 season.

Woodaz improved a lot.

Sammy Brown improved tremendously between 1st half if the season to 2nd half if the season.

Going way back to beginning of the season, Kobe McCloud didn’t look too bad for a severely undersized LB.

My disappointment in LB development has been Jamaal Anderson …he’s got excellent speed, but is a poor tackler and, from what little I’ve seen from him during plays from scrimmage, doesn’t defeat blocks well and just doesn’t seem aggressive. Whether Wes Goodwin is to blame or not, J.Anderson represents a case of a LB that hasn’t developed much under Goodwin’s role as LB coach.
